Re: few ?? about a t28 upgrade

I have a '99 9-3 which is identical engine-wise. The injectors are good for just about 280hp although with low torque for this power level.
If you run stock boost pressure and with no other mods my guess is that the injectors will be well within their limits. The larger turbo will produce more power due to its greater efficiency, but don't expect anything close to 280 with the 0.8-0.9 bar stock boost pressure.
Just for reference I can tell you that with T28 compressor only, 3" exhaust and 1.2 bar (17.5psi) at the redline the stock injectors are OK.
To be honest, unless your turbo has failed, in which case rebuilding to T28 spec is a smart move (as the cost is about the same), you only need an upgraded turbo if you plan to achieve over the 250hp or so capability of the stock T25. 250 is easy with ECU, Viggen I/C and exhaust.
Also, if you do decide to upgrade its worthwhile to upgrade both ends of the turbo, not just the compressor.
